If making the homemade bars (which I suggest!), preheat oven to 350℉. If using store-bought sugar cookies, proceed to Step 5.
In a large bowl, cream together 1 cup unsalted butter and 1 cup granulated sugar on medium speed for 20-30 seconds. Mix in 1 large egg, 2 teaspoons vanilla extract, and 1 teaspoon almond extract. On low speed, mix in 1 ½ teaspoons baking powder, ½ teaspoon salt, and 2 ¼ cups all-purpose flour.
Press dough into a greased or parchment-lined 9x13 metal pan.
Bake bars at 350℉ for 18-20 minutes until edges and top are slightly browned (we want them to be a bit crunchy).
Allow bars to completely cool, then break apart and crumble (they do not need to be pulverized into crumbs).
Using an electric or stand-mixer, mix together the crushed sugar cookies and 8 oz. cream cheese. Mix until cookies are broken down and everything is incorporated.
Roll into 1 tablespoon sized balls and freeze on a cookie sheet for 30-60 minutes.
Dip in melted white 12 oz. almond bark. See tip in notes; for smoother almond bark add a dollop of butter flavored crisco.
Immediately top with sprinkles.
Store sugar cookie truffles in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week (freeze if storing longer). Because they have cream cheese, they need to stay chilled until serving.
